Cells Format of a Expression

Hello,

I am a beginner on QlikView and i want to set a specific format for one of my expression ( here Own Costs which is a value of Indicators field ), because i would like that it looks like as a Total column (such as Total here):

Capture.PNG

Have you got a idea ? Do i use the Dimensionality function ?

Hi Sebastien,

I presume that you mean like this:

If so, change the text colour against the expressions, e.g. :

if(INDICATORS = 'Own costs', lightblue(), black())

Just substitute the colours that you require.
